Morgan Stanley, founded in 1935 by Henry Sturgis Morgan and Harold Stanley as a spin-off from J.P. Morgan & Co., is a leading global financial services firm headquartered in New York City. Initially focused on investment banking, it has evolved into a diversified powerhouse offering wealth management, institutional securities, and asset management services, catering to corporations, governments, institutions, and high-net-worth individuals. With a strong presence in mergers and acquisitions, underwriting, and trading, Morgan Stanley manages billions in assets and is known for its sophisticated financial advisory services. The firm has adapted to modern markets by expanding its digital offerings and wealth management division, notably through its 2020 acquisition of E*TRADE, solidifying its position as a Wall Street titan.

Morgan Stanley's Q1 2016 Portfolio in Review

As of Q1 2016, Morgan Stanley held 7,092 positions worth $260B, down 5.9% from $276B the previous quarter. Its ten largest holdings account for 13% of the portfolio.

Morgan Stanley withdrew a net $14.6B in Q1 2016, closing 197 positions and reducing 3,623 holdings. Its most notable exit was KEURIG GREEN MTN INC, an estimated $766M position sold in full.

By sector, the portfolio is most concentrated in Healthcare at 9.1% of assets, down from 9.2% a quarter earlier, followed by Technology and Financials.

Against the trend, Morgan Stanley opened a new position in Welbilt, Inc. worth $69.6M.
